    Enter the musical journey of a legend with "Bob Dylan: A History in 12 Playlists." This meticulously crafted book offers a unique lens into the life and career of Bob Dylan, one of the most influential artists of our time. Spanning across 39 albums and over 700 songs, this book divides Dylan's illustrious career into 12 listenable, carefully curated playlists. Each playlist corresponds to a distinct period of Dylan's musical evolution, providing not only an enjoyable listening experience but also a deep historical context to his works.

    At its core, this book celebrates the remarkable fusion of rock, blues, and soul that emerged during this transformative period. Through vivid storytelling and meticulous research, readers are transported to the heart of the music scene, where a group of trailblazing musicians united around a shared passion for music and a desire to push the boundaries of the genre. The narrative also delves into the lives of other remarkable talents who played pivotal roles in this influential era. Delaney Bramlett, whose appearance on the groundbreaking television show "Shindig!" propelled him into the limelight, joins forces with fellow musicians, including Joey Cooper, Mac Davis, and Jackie DeShannon, to explore songwriting and form Delaney & Bonnie and Friends. Bonnie O'Farrell, a prodigious singer with a soulful voice, shares her journey from St. Louis to Los Angeles, where she becomes the first white Ikette in the Ike & Tina Turner Revue and eventually marries Delaney Bramlett. The book highlights the pivotal collaborations and synergies that emerged within the ranks of Delaney & Bonnie and Friends, particularly when George Harrison and Eric Clapton became captivated by their magnetic performances. The resulting creative alliances lead to the recording of George Harrison's iconic album, "All Things Must Pass," with contributions from Leon Russell, Clapton, and others. The narrative also explores the formation of the Mad Dogs and Englishmen band, which accompanied Joe Cocker on a transformative tour and produced an influential album and movie. Throughout the book, the author underscores the unique blend of musical styles and influences that these artists brought to their collaborations. From the driving, lurchy, churchy rock and roll songs that Russell described to the deep-rooted blues roots of Southerners like Delaney and Bonnie, Rita Coolidge, and Bobby Whitlock, to the English heritage embraced by Eric Clapton and George Harrison, each artist carries a fragment of the blues and rock ethos. The book celebrates their ability to transcend geographical constraints and create a timeless sound that resonated with audiences worldwide.     Unleash the Power of Automation on Your Mac with JavaScript! Unlock the power of macOS automation with JavaScript. In this practical guide, seasoned scripter Jesse Shanks introduces JavaScript for Automation (JXA), a versatile scripting language tailored for streamlining workflows on your Mac. With JXA's familiar JavaScript syntax coupled with native integration into macOS, you can eliminate repetitive tasks, manipulate files and data, automate workflows between apps, and build custom scripts to boost productivity. The book explores fundamentals like working with application objects, manipulating dialogs and user interactions, accessing system events, and incorporating practical scripting additions. You'll walk through detailed real-world scripts demonstrating how to dynamically create documents in Pages, fetch data from the internet, automate playlists in Music, process files across multiple apps, and more. Advanced sections cover leveraging shell scripts, building workflows with Automator, distributing scripts as macOS services, and using JXA scripts to create menu bar apps. With encapsulated code blocks and annotated explanations, the book teaches progressively across beginner and intermediate skill levels. Both practical tutorial and reference guide, JavaScript for Automation brings together the versatility of JavaScript with the extensibility of macOS to help you accomplish incredible feats of automation.     "Bess: Sweetheart of the City" is a captivating novel that delves deep into the world of fame, power, and the pursuit of justice. In this riveting tale, readers are transported to the heart of New York City, where the lives of three compelling characters-Bess Myerson, Judge Hortense Gabel, and Andy Capasso-intersect in a drama of crime and politics that will keep you on the edge of your seat.Follow Bess Myerson, a charismatic and enigmatic figure, as she faces a trial that threatens to unravel her reputation and legacy. With a career that has touched the heights of success, she must now navigate the treacherous waters of public scrutiny and the relentless pursuit of truth. In 1945, she was Miss America and spoke against anti-Semitism when discriminated against on her tour. She became a popular figure during the early years of television and parlayed that success into a political career, all the way to a run for the Democratic nomination for Senator from New York.Andy Capasso, known as the Sewer King of New York, finds himself in the center of a storm of scandal and corruption. His life takes a dramatic turn as he grapples with the consequences of his choices and the shadows of his past. He is linked with powerful figures of the Genovese crime family and the new U.S. Attorney of the Southern District of New York, Rudy Giuliani. His wife Nancy has ridden with him to success and an apartment on Fifth Avenue. But when she finds out that Bess is the other woman, she initiates the most notorious divorce case in New York history.Judge Hortense Gabel, a symbol of integrity and justice, is ensnared in a web of allegations that challenge her very identity. Her daughter, Sukhreet Gabel, stands at the crossroads of loyalty and truth, torn between family ties and the pursuit of justice. When it appears that the Judge has done a favor for Bess in helping Andy in his divorce, the whole mess ends up on the front pages of the New York papers and in a Federal courtroom.As these characters face the crucible of the courtroom, the novel explores profound themes of resilience, fairness, and the enduring power of the human spirit.
